The Five Projects
Oriel Wind Farm
Up to 375 MW off the coast of Co Louth.

North Irish Sea Array (NISA)
500 MW off the coast of Co Dublin, Co Meath and Co Louth.

Dublin Array
Up to 824 MW, off the coast of Co Dublin and Co. Wicklow.

Codling Wind Park
Up to 1,300 MW off the coast of Co. Wicklow, between Greystones and Wicklow Town.

Arklow Bank Wind Park
Up to 800 MW off the coast of south Co. Wicklow and north Co. Wexford.

The Numbers Behind the Video
“Right now, Ireland imports over 80% of its energy, nearly all of it fossil fuels bought on global markets that we can't control.”
Since this video was scripted the latest report from the SEAI Ireland’s Energy Supply & Security of Supply 2025 has been published and energy imports are now at 78.2 per cent. Of these energy imports 92.8 per cent were fossil fuels.
“These East Coast projects have the potential to power the equivalent of every Irish home and more.”
The installed capacity of these projects is 3.8 GW.
Using the 45 per cent capacity factor set out in the terms and conditions for the Offshore Renewable Electricity Support Scheme auction this results in an anticipated annual generation of 14.98 GWh of electricity.
The CSO reports total residential electricity consumption for 2025 as 9.1 GWh.
“Coastal communities would see millions of euro a year invested in nearby villages and towns”
Under the terms and conditions of the Offshore Renewable Electricity Support Scheme successful participants must pay €2 per MWh of electricity produced into a community benefit fund.
For the three successful ORESS projects with a combined capacity of 3.1 GW this would translate to €24.4 million per annum. Arklow Bank and Oriel are not ORESS projects but will also have their own community benefit funds additional to this.
“and they displace enormous amounts of harmful CO2 every year.”
The SEAI estimates that every KWh of electricity in 2025 produced 197 grammes of CO2.
Using the 45 per cent capacity factor set out in the terms and conditions for the Offshore Renewable Electricity Support Scheme auction this results in an anticipated annual generation from the 3.8 GW for the east-coast projects of 14.98 GWh of electricity.
This would lead to avoided emissions of 2.96 million tonnes of CO2.
Total electricity emissions for Ireland in 2024 were 6.9 million tonnes.
“Together they could meet over half of Ireland's daily electricity demand.”
The installed capacity of these projects is 3.8 GW or 3,800 MW The record for peak demand on the Irish electricity system is 6,024 MW, set on 8 January 2025.
